CONCLUSION
Battery technology has undergone significant advancements since the
1990s, introducing a range of new and exciting chemistries to cater to the
increasing demands of the power grid.
As these technologies start to materialize in practical applications,
ensuring safety becomes crucial for their successful operation.
This involves the establishment of safety testing standards and the
implementation of site and personal safety protocols.
It should be noted that not all battery chemistries are suitable for
every application. Therefore, engineers must carefully consider the
distinct characteristics, maintenance requirements, and operational
prerequisites of each technology before implementation. Additionally,
regulatory bodies responsible for enforcing safety measures will
adapt model codes to incorporate specific attributes relevant to their
respective states or municipalities.
